Who Can Apply

AVBOB is committed to fostering diversity and inclusivity, and encourages applications from a wide range of individuals who meet the following essential criteria:

  • South African Citizen: Applicants must be South African citizens with a valid Identity Document (ID). This is a fundamental requirement for all learnership programmes in the country.
  • Unemployed: This programme is specifically designed to address unemployment. Therefore, applicants must currently be unemployed and actively seeking employment opportunities.
  • Age Requirement: Applicants must typically be between the ages of 18 and 35. This age bracket is often targeted for learnerships to support the youth in entering the workforce.
  • Minimum Educational Qualification: A matric certificate (National Senior Certificate) or an equivalent NQF Level 4 qualification is the minimum educational requirement. Proficiency in English and Mathematics or Mathematical Literacy is often advantageous.
  • No Prior Long-Term Insurance Qualification: Applicants should generally not hold an existing NQF Level 5 or higher qualification directly related to Long-Term Insurance. The programme is designed for individuals seeking to enter the industry, not those already qualified.
  • Strong Communication Skills: Effective verbal and written communication skills are paramount in the financial services sector, particularly when interacting with clients and colleagues.
  • Basic Computer Literacy: Familiarity with basic computer applications such as Microsoft Word, Excel, and Outlook is essential for navigating modern work environments.
  • Aptitude for Learning: A genuine eagerness to learn, a proactive attitude, and a commitment to personal and professional growth are highly valued attributes.
  • Resilience and Professionalism: The financial services industry demands a high degree of professionalism, ethical conduct, and the ability to work effectively under pressure.

Specific learnership intakes may have additional requirements, which will be clearly outlined in the official application advertisements.

How to Apply

Applying for the AVBOB Long-Term Insurance Unemployed Learnership Programme is a straightforward process designed to ensure a fair and efficient selection. Interested candidates are strongly encouraged to carefully follow these steps:

  1. Monitor Official Channels: Keep a close watch on AVBOB’s official career portal (www.avbob.co.za/careers), reputable job boards (e.g., PNet, Careers24, LinkedIn), and their official social media channels for announcements regarding learnership application periods. These platforms will provide the most accurate and up-to-date information on available opportunities.
  2. Review the Application Requirements: Before commencing the application, meticulously read through the specific requirements for the advertised learnership. Pay close attention to eligibility criteria, required documents, and any specific instructions.
  3. Prepare Your Documents: Gather all necessary supporting documentation in advance. This typically includes:
    • A comprehensive and up-to-date Curriculum Vitae (CV) highlighting your educational background, any relevant experience (even informal), and contact details.
    • Certified copies of your Identity Document (ID).
    • Certified copies of your Matric Certificate (National Senior Certificate) or equivalent qualification.
    • Any other relevant certificates or testimonials that may support your application.
  4. Complete the Online Application Form: Most applications will be submitted through AVBOB’s online career portal. Create a profile if you don’t already have one, and accurately complete all sections of the application form. Ensure all personal details, educational history, and any relevant work experience are correctly entered.

  1. Craft a Compelling Cover Letter (Optional but Recommended): While not always mandatory, a well-written cover letter can significantly enhance your application. Use this opportunity to express your genuine interest in the learnership, explain why you believe you are a suitable candidate, and highlight how your skills and aspirations align with AVBOB’s values and the objectives of the programme.
  2. Submit Your Application: Double-check all information and attached documents before submitting your application. Once submitted, you should receive an automated confirmation email.
  3. Be Prepared for Assessment: Shortlisted candidates will typically undergo a rigorous selection process which may include:
    • Online Assessments: These could test cognitive abilities, numerical reasoning, verbal comprehension, and sometimes personality traits.
    • Interviews: Successful candidates will be invited for interviews, which may be conducted virtually or in person. Be prepared to discuss your motivations, understanding of the long-term insurance industry, and future career aspirations.
    • Reference Checks: AVBOB may contact your provided references to verify information and gain further insight into your character and work ethic.
  4. Patience and Follow-Up: The selection process can take time. Exercise patience and refrain from making frequent unsolicited follow-up calls or emails. However, if you haven’t heard back within a reasonable timeframe (as specified in the application notice), a polite inquiry is acceptable.
